P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Builder - Stub - Server - wie nennt / funktioniert dieses System?



Iaa_1
17.05.2010, 14:57
Der Titel ist die Frage:
Wie nennt man das System bei dem eine Stub, ein Builder und am Ende eine Server.exe entsteht?

Atropos
17.05.2010, 15:02
Builder-System?
Dafür kenne ich keinen offiziellen Namen.
Zur Funktion:
Die Stub ist das Programm welches du konfigurieren möchtest (zB ein Trojaner wo du noch setzen musst wohin er verbindet).
Der Builder setzt diese Konfiguration.
Und Server.exe ist dann die konfigurierte Stub.
Die glaube ich 2 häufigsten Methoden sind die EOF-Methode und die Ressource-Methode.
Bei der EOF-Methode werden die Daten ans Ende der Datei geschrieben (welches Nullbytes enthält und somit unwichtig zur Ausführung ist) und in der Stub dann wieder ausgelesen.
Das führt aber zu einer Änderung der Dateigröße und löst die Avira-meldung TR/Dropper.Gen aus.
Die Ressource-Methode fügt der Stub einfach eine Ressource hinzu mit den passenden Daten (am schönsten in XML geschrieben).
Mit der EOF-Methode hat Sawyer ein Beispiel hier reingestellt.

Zer0Flag
17.05.2010, 15:13
"Mit der EOF-Methode hat Sawyer ein Beispiel hier reingestellt."

Von mir gibt es in der C++ Section ein beispiel Builder zur Resource Methode.

Greetz Zer0Flag